Advertisements by Cash. We may be compensated if you click this ad. Ad Financial obligation relief isn't a fast fix for cash problems. The process, likewise called debt settlement or financial obligation resolution, involves paying a company to negotiate with your financial institutions in hopes of getting them to accept go for an amount that's less than you owe.
We only advise debt relief when other, more favorable alternatives aren't viable; debt consolidation loans and credit counseling typically make better monetary sense for customers. Debt relief companies may recommend that you stop paying creditors to try and increase their bargaining power, nearly definitely to the hinderance of your credit rating.
Not all kinds of financial obligation are eligible for financial obligation relief, and there's no assurance your lenders will accept the settlement proposed by the financial obligation relief company. The Accredited Debt Relief website indicates that its debt settlement programs take between 24 and 48 months to finish, which is normal for the industry. While many companies cite a fee variety, Accredited's site is more transparent by revealing that its charge is "normally" 25%. A declaration on its homepage that says, "This won't impact your credit rating!" is misinforming because it provides consumers the impression that its debt settlement program will not affect your credit report.
Only at the really bottom of the homepage does the company disclose that financial obligation settlement "might negatively impact your credit for a time." If you choose that financial obligation settlement isn't a great choice for you, Accredited works with affiliates that use financial obligation consolidation loans. Keep in mind that these two products are really various, as are the potential implications for your credit history.
